31、ionssometimes simultaneously.2.3 an insight into body languagebody language is the non-verbal behavior related to movement, either of any part of the body, or the body as a whole. in short all communicative body movements are generally classified as body language. body language communication is prob
32、ably one of the most talked about, and most obvious nonverbal communication form.studies have revealed some fascinating facts about our use of body language communication. for example, the majority of our communication is expressed through body language. albert mehrabain, a communication professor,
33、discovered that only about 7 percent of the emotional meaning of a message is communicated through explicit verbal channels. about 38 percent is communicated by paralanguage, which is basically the use of the voice. about 55 percent comes through nonverbal, which includes such things as gesture, pos
34、ture,facial expression,etc.2.3.1 classification of body languagein language history, each linguist always have their unique classification of body language. genelle morain (chen yongpei) divided body language into movements, gesture, posture, facial expression, touch, gaze and distancing.yang ping i
35、dentified body language as the principal part of nonverbal communication, which studies the meaning conveyed through movements of any parts of the body.bi jiwan developed the contents of body language into basic posture,gesture, basic manners and movements of any part of the body.based on the above

45、 messages of body language from the four areas in greater detail. body language in middle english classroom occurs with facial expressions, eye contact, gesture, touching.3.1 facial expressions and their application in middle english classroom teachinga facial expression results from one or more mot
46、ions or positions of the muscles of the face. they are closely associated with our emotions. all humans are capable of faking a happy or a sad face, a smile or a frown. we can not determine how long to keep it or how quickly to let it goes.3.1.1 function of facial expressionsthe human face is the mo
47、st complex and versatile of all species. for humans, the face is a rich and versatile instrument serving many different functions. it serves as a window to display ones own motivational state. this makes ones behavior more predictable and understandable to others and improves communication. a quick
48、facial display can reveal the speakers attitude about the information being conveyed. face is the most noted part of the our body. facial expression is a look on a persons face and facial cues are the first information that we give to or receive from others. people also make predictions from the fac
49、e about the person they meet.the most important function of facial expression is to express emotions and feeling. a teacher also is a human being. they feel bad sometimes. so, the teacher need to mask their emotion such as anger,fear, disgust or sadness. they should try to stay calm and succeeds in
50、controlling their face under any situation in class. give your students a smile friendly, they will feel your kindness.facial expressions provide clues ones personal trait. as a teacher, we should never forget that most students have the ability to infer ones character from ones habitual facial expr
51、essions. so, less indifferent, more warmth; less melancholy, more sunshine. facial expressions demonstrate approval or disapproval and register understanding. and moreover, in the middle school, girls always reveal their emotions more often than boys. sometimes, some male students smile only when ha
52、ppy or amused and some female students even smile when there are negative message.3.1.2 application of facial expressions in middle english classroom teaching nowadays, all people and thus certainly teachers and students use facial expressions to form impressions of another. facial expression betwee
53、n teachers and students is one of the most important types of nonverbal signals in the classroom and facial cues are the first information that we give to or receive from others. however, chinese middle english teacher are accustomed to controlling their emotions or even hiding their true feelings a
54、nd emotions. moreover, in chinese traditions, the teachers dominated by confucianism, are required to be serious before students. otherwise, they feel their image of authority will be damaged. however, the american teachers frequent eyebrow rising, head wagging and face making seem to be natural and
55、 popular to the students. in american culture, people are good at showing their feelings and emotions. teachers regard the classroom as a stage and they themselves act like actors to create relaxing atmosphere for good learning and teaching.a teachers facial expressions stand for the attitude to his
56、 students. a cold hard stare has long been in the repertoire of teachers weapons. similarly, a smile can be useful tool in reinforcing desired student behaviors. nearly every student likes teachers with smile on their faces instead of those who wear frowns, scowls and grimaces. a smiling teacher is
57、thought to convey warmth and encouragement to his students.smith thinks that such a teacher promotes a supportive and nonthreatening classroom atmosphere, which aids students positive attitudes and corresponding achievement. that is, if a teacher smiles frequently, he will be perceived as more likab
